Albrecht And Heck Named To ACC All-Academic Team

NOTRE DAME, Ind. — University of Notre Dame women’s golfers Emma Albrecht and Abby Heck were named to the 2019 All-ACC Academic Team the Atlantic Coast Conference announced on Wednesday (June 19).

Albrecht and Duke’s Virginia Elena Carta had the added distinction of earning the honor for a fourth consecutive season.

Minimum academic requirements for selection to the All-ACC Academic Team are a 3.0 grade point average for the previous semester and a 3.0 cumulative average during one’s academic career. Athletic achievements during the most recent season are also considered in selecting the All-ACC Academic Team.

Albrecht, who graduated in May as a science-business major, wrapped up her stellar Fighting Irish career at the 2019 NCAA East Lansing Regional as she participated in NCAA play for a fourth consecutive season (twice as an individual). Albrecht posted a team-best 73.07 season stroke average over 29 total rounds. She fired 13 rounds at par or better, including eight such rounds under par (three rounds in the 60s). She recorded seven top-25 finishes over her first nine starts this season, which included a tie for fourth place at the Bettie Lou Evans Invitational (70-71-72=213) and a share of second place at the Westbrook Invitational (70-68-70=208). She also carded seven straight rounds at par or better spanning from the third round of the Minnesota Invitational through the third round of the Bettie Lou Evans Invitational last fall.

Albrecht will begin medical school this summer and boasts the program’s top career stroke average with a 73.38 mark. She set the single-season stroke average in 2017-18 with a 72.31 mark. She also ranks second in program history for career percentage of rounds counted (.962) and tied the single-season percentage of rounds counted mark in 2017-18 with a 29-for-29 showing (1.000) and in 2018-19 with a 26-for-26 (1.000) effort. Over her four seasons, posted four of the top-10 stroke averages in program history.For her career, finished with nine Top-10 finishes and has 24 Top-20 showings.

Heck, a mathematics and Spanish double major, finished her sophomore season this past year, with a 74.19 stroke average (third-lowest on the team). She was named to the Dean’s List following the 2019 spring semester. Starting all nine tournaments, Heck ranked second on the team with six rounds under par (team-high four rounds in the 60’s) and added two rounds at even par. She was the only Notre Dame player in 2018-19 to fire multiple rounds in the 60’s at the same tournament (Schooner Fall Classic, Moon Golf Invitational).

This past season, Heck earned a career-best runner-up finish to lead Notre Dame at the Moon Golf Invitational (Feb. 18-19), carding rounds of 68-70-69=207 (-9). She tied for 26th place at the ACC Championship (April 18-20), carding a final tournament score of 225 (76-71-78).
